Hanna had been mopey ever since the fight she had with Caleb. It's partly why she took her time getting back to her dorm. She didn't have any classes on Mondays anyway.

As soon as she walked into the room, she was greeted by a tiny ball of fuzz.

"I thought you'd be gone by now," Hanna sighed at the kitten staring back at her.

She noticed it was still around Friday and left out some food for it while she was gone, but she thought for sure the kitty would be gone by the time she got back.

"I'm not really a cat person," she told the kitten.

It looked back at her with big kitten eyes. "Mew."

Just like that, some of Hanna's sadness disappeared. "Fine, you can stay."

Now, she just needed to give it a name and hoped it got along with Pascal.
